A handfasting ceremony has its roots in ancient Celtic tradition, symbolizing the binding together of two people (and the origin of the phrase "tying the knot!"). It symbolizes the notion of the couple binding their lives together and the union of their hopes and desires. The couple will join hands, which symbolizes their free will to enter into the marriage and have them bound together.
Love locks are a symbol of love and commitment where lovers lock a padlock on a chain or gate and then throw away the key, symbolically locking their love forever. Colleen and Sean had a padlock engraved with their names and wedding date and locked it on Helsinki’s Bridge of Love in Finland. There are many bridges of love around the world, but Finland is the only place that has passed an ordinance that these locks will never be removed.
